Last update: 7 hours agoMontserrat Travel Spotlight: Summer is shaping up as a top time to visit Montserrat, with the Soufrière Hills Volcano setting the scene for calm seas, mango season, sea turtle nesting, and island festivals—starting with the Montserrat Calabash Festival 2026 (July 18–26) and beach opener Calasplash, then PRIME 2026 (July 24–26). Regional Tourism Trade: St. Maarten’s SMART travel trade show (June 22–26) is on track for a record year, with Montserrat among confirmed exhibitors.
